The Advancement of Lorry Lighting
The earliest automobiles relied on oil or acetylene lamps, which gave minimal illumination and called for regular maintenance. The intro of electrical incandescent bulbs in the early 20th century marked a significant enhancement, allowing more reputable and brighter lighting. Halogen light bulbs later became the market criterion as a result of their improved efficiency and life expectancy.
By the late 20th century, high-intensity discharge (HID) lamps emerged, using dramatically greater illumination and variety. Nevertheless, the genuine change began with the adoption of light-emitting diode (LED) technology. LEDs provided reduced energy usage, longer lifespan, compact dimension, and design flexibility, making them excellent for modern vehicle applications. Today, LED systems are commonly utilized throughout fronts lights, taillights, daytime running lights (DRLs), and interior ambient illumination.
Leading vehicle lights providers such as Hella, Valeo, Osram, and Koito Production have played a considerable function in driving these technical developments.
Core Technologies in Modern Vehicle Illumination
1. Halogen and HID Equipments
Although gradually being replaced, halogen lights are still made use of in lots of entry-level lorries because of their inexpensive and convenience of substitute. HID lamps, on the other hand, utilize an electrical arc in between tungsten electrodes within a gas-filled tube, producing a bright white light. While extra effective than halogens, HID systems call for warm-up time and facility ballast systems.
2. LED Lighting Systems
LEDs have come to be the leading technology in contemporary vehicle lights because of their performance and adaptability. They create light through electroluminescence, where electrons recombine with electron holes within a semiconductor, launching power in the form of photons.
Secret benefits of LED systems consist of:
Lower power consumption
Immediate lighting
High longevity and shock resistance
Style adaptability for trademark illumination designs
LEDs also enable sophisticated styling features such as dynamic turn indicator and customizable daytime running light trademarks, which have come to be essential brand identification elements in modern-day automobiles.
3. Laser and OLED Lights
Laser fronts lights represent a sophisticated development, offering very high brightness and long-range lighting. These systems are normally made use of in combination with phosphor converters to create risk-free white light for road usage.
Organic light-emitting diode (OLED) technology is progressively made use of in rear lighting systems. OLEDs offer consistent light circulation and allow for extremely specific and slim lights layouts, which are especially eye-catching for deluxe cars.
Intelligent and Adaptive Lights Equipments
Modern illumination options are no longer static. Flexible lighting systems adjust beam patterns based on driving conditions, speed, climate, and road geometry. These systems enhance exposure while minimizing glow for oncoming traffic.
Matrix LED and pixel light innovations divide the front lights right into multiple individually controlled sections. This allows the system to uniquely dim particular locations while preserving complete lighting somewhere else. For instance, when an approaching lorry is found, just the appropriate LED segments are lowered, ensuring optimum visibility without blinding various other motorists.
Such technologies are significantly integrated with innovative driver-assistance systems (ADAS), enabling better control between lighting, video cameras, and sensing units.
Security and Governing Standards
Vehicle lights systems are regulated by rigorous global policies to guarantee road safety and uniformity. Specifications such as those created by the United Nations Economic Compensation for Europe (UNECE) and the Culture of Automotive Engineers (SAE) define requirements for brightness, light beam pattern, color temperature level, and placement.
These regulations ensure that lights systems:
Give ample road lighting
Decrease glare and diversion
Keep exposure in diverse ecological problems
Compliance with these criteria is important for global auto suppliers, influencing both design and engineering processes.
Duty of Lights in Lorry Layout and Branding
Beyond functionality, lights plays an essential role in automobile looks and brand identification. Distinctive front lights and taillight designs are typically used to make lorries quickly well-known, also in low-light problems.
For instance, continuous LED light bars, dynamic turn indicators, and welcome lighting computer animations have become trademark style elements in modern-day lorries. Automakers leverage these attributes to create psychological connections with consumers and distinguish their items in a very open market.
Power Efficiency and Electric Cars
With the surge of electrical cars (EVs), power efficiency has come to be a lot more crucial. Because lights systems attract power from the lorry’s battery, decreasing energy intake straight adds to expanded driving range.
LED and OLED innovations are particularly fit for EVs because of their reduced power needs. Additionally, intelligent illumination systems that adjust brightness based on ambient conditions assist additionally enhance energy usage.
Future Patterns in Lorry Lights Solutions
The future of car lights is closely connected to independent driving and clever movement. A number of arising fads are anticipated to form the sector:
1. Communication Lighting (Vehicle-to-X).
Lights systems will increasingly be used to communicate with pedestrians, bikers, and other lorries. For instance, independent cars might utilize details light patterns to suggest when it is risk-free to go across.
2. Totally Digital Lighting Surfaces.
Developments in micro-LED innovation are enabling high-resolution electronic light displays on automobile exteriors. These surfaces can forecast symbols, cautions, or even customized messages.
3. Combination with Artificial Intelligence.
AI-powered lighting systems will dynamically adjust to driving settings in real time, enhancing exposure and safety with minimal driver input.
4. Sustainable Lighting Materials.
As environmental concerns grow, makers are discovering recyclable materials and energy-efficient production techniques to lower the ecological impact of lights systems.
